Features Matter, But Only in Context

Features are important. They just need context. A full body massage chair can sound like the obvious choice, but “full body” should mean that the chair supports your shoulders, back, hips, calves, and feet in a way that actually feels comfortable.

The same applies to a zero gravity massage chair. Zero gravity can help create a deeply reclined, weight-distributed position, but not every recline angle feels equally natural to every user. The best zero gravity massage chair for you depends on how your body feels in that position, not just whether the spec sheet includes the feature.

Feature What It Sounds Like Online What You Should Verify
4D massage chair More control over roller depth, rhythm, and intensity. Does the pressure feel refined and adjustable, or too strong for your body?
5D massage chair A premium, advanced massage experience with added responsiveness. Does the added technology create a better session for you, or just a longer feature list?
AI massage chair Smart personalization, guided controls, or adaptive programs. Does the chair feel easier to use and more tailored to your body?
body scanning massage chair The chair detects your body before starting the program. Does the scan find your shoulders and massage zones accurately?
massage chair zero gravity A reclined position designed to distribute body weight more evenly. Does the recline feel natural, stable, and comfortable for your height and room?
full body massage chairs Coverage from upper back through legs and feet. Do all contact points align, especially shoulders, hips, calves, and feet?

The point is not to ignore features. The point is to connect each feature to your actual comfort. A luxury massage chair should feel luxurious because it fits your body and routine, not just because it has a longer list of technology.

Price Without Fit Is the Most Expensive Shortcut

It is smart to compare massage chair price. It is also smart to understand the full massage chair cost, including delivery, warranty, service, and whether the chair will genuinely be used over time.

But price alone should not drive the decision. A chair on a massage chair for sale page is not automatically the right buy. A list of massage chairs sale offers can be helpful, but a discount does not solve poor fit, wrong intensity, difficult controls, or a chair that feels awkward in your home.

A premium massage chair is a long-term comfort decision. A high end massage chair should be evaluated by value, fit, service, and daily usefulness, not only by the largest discount or the most impressive product photo.

Smart buying note: A lower price can be attractive, but the better question is whether the chair fits your body, your space, your expectations, and your long-term routine. A well-fit chair you use consistently may offer more value than a discounted chair that never feels quite right.

What to Check Before Choosing Any Massage Chair

Before you buy, slow the process down enough to ask the questions that matter. A strong shortlist should answer more than “Which chair has the most features?” It should answer “Which chair will I actually use?”

Question Why It Matters Best Next Step
Does the chair fit my body? The rollers, air cells, seat, calf section, and footrest should align naturally. Test in person or speak with a specialist before buying.
Does the pressure feel right? Too much intensity can make a premium chair difficult to use regularly. Try gentle, medium, and deep programs before deciding.
Does it fit my room? Recline clearance, doorway path, and visual scale matter in daily life. Measure the space and confirm delivery logistics.
Will more than one person use it? Shared households need flexibility across body types and preferences. Compare models with multiple users in mind.
What happens after delivery? Warranty, service, setup, and support affect long-term confidence. Ask about ownership support before purchasing.
